Modular synthesis of alkyne-substituted ruthenium polypyridyl complexes suitable for "click" coupling

Inorg Chem. 2013 Mar 18;52(6):2796-8. doi: 10.1021/ic302827s. Epub 2013 Mar 4.

Abstract

A modular synthetic method has been developed for the preparation of Ru polypyridyl complexes bearing a terminal alkyne. This method proceeds through a readily accessible intermediate with a silyl-protected alkyne and allows access to a variety of five- and six-coordinate Ru complexes. These complexes can be easily attached to azide-functionalized electrode surfaces with only slight perturbation of the redox properties of the parent complex.
